Antique Silver Document Case from Burma

About the Item

Antique silver document case from Burma Burmese, late 19th century Measures: Length 48cm, diameter 6cm This wonderful object is a Burmese marriage document case. The case is cylindrical in form, and its silver surface is profusely adorned with both pierced and etched decorations, the motifs of which derive from Buddhist symbols.
